行业资讯 javascript前端一定会用到吗

javascript前端一定会用到吗

143
 

JavaScript前端一定会用到吗

引言: JavaScript是一种广泛应用于Web前端开发的编程语言,它赋予了网页动态和交互性,为用户带来更好的使用体验。然而,随着前端技术的不断发展,出现了许多新的前端技术和框架,一些开发者开始质疑是否前端一定会用到JavaScript。本文将探讨JavaScript在前端开发中的地位和重要性,帮助读者了解为什么JavaScript仍然是前端开发的重要组成部分。

一、JavaScript的历史与现状 JavaScript是一种由Netscape公司(现为Mozilla)开发的脚本语言,最初是为了增强静态HTML页面的交互性而设计。随着互联网的快速发展,JavaScript逐渐成为了Web前端开发的主要语言之一。它可以在浏览器中直接运行,使得网页能够实现动态更新、表单验证、数据交互等功能。

随着HTML5和CSS3的出现,JavaScript在前端开发中的地位更加突出。HTML5为JavaScript提供了更多的API和功能,例如Canvas绘图、地理定位、本地存储等。同时,CSS3为页面提供了更多的样式选择器和动画效果,使得JavaScript可以更加灵活地操作页面元素和样式。

二、前端开发中的JavaScript应用 JavaScript在前端开发中有着广泛的应用,主要包括以下几个方面:

  1. 页面交互和动态效果:JavaScript使得网页可以根据用户的操作实现动态更新和交互效果,例如响应式导航菜单、页面滚动效果、弹出框等。

  2. 表单验证:JavaScript可以对用户输入的数据进行实时验证,确保用户输入的内容符合要求。

  3. Ajax数据交互:通过JavaScript的Ajax技术,网页可以在不刷新整个页面的情况下与服务器进行数据交互,实现异步加载数据。

  4. 动态渲染:JavaScript可以根据后端数据动态生成页面内容,实现前后端分离的开发模式。

  5. 响应式设计:JavaScript可以根据不同的设备和屏幕大小调整页面布局和样式,实现响应式设计。

三、新兴前端技术与JavaScript的关系 近年来,前端技术发展迅猛,出现了许多新的前端技术和框架,例如React、Angular、Vue等。这些新兴技术可以帮助开发者更高效地构建复杂的前端应用,并提供更好的用户体验。

然而,这些新技术并不意味着JavaScript会被取代。相反,它们往往是构建在JavaScript基础之上的,使用JavaScript作为核心语言,并且扩展了JavaScript的功能和性能。这些新技术虽然提供了更高级的抽象和封装,但仍然依赖于JavaScript来实现其功能。

四、结论 JavaScript在前端开发中扮演着不可替代的重要角色。它是Web前端的基石,赋予了网页交互性、动态性和灵活性。虽然新兴的前端技术和框架提供了更高效的开发方式,但它们并不会取代JavaScript,而是在其基础上进行拓展和扩展。对于前端开发者来说,深入学习和掌握JavaScript仍然是必不可少的,因为它是实现前端交互和功能的基础。希望本文能帮助读者认识到JavaScript在前端开发中的重要性,并在前端开发中充分发挥其优势。

更新:2023-09-17 00:00:12 © 著作权归作者所有
QQ
微信